Financial Performance - The net profit of Vantone Real Estate for 2016 was -254,550,622.79 RMB, resulting in an ending undistributed profit of 37,872,846.30 RMB[3]. - The basic earnings per share for 2016 was 0.0706 RMB, a significant improvement from -0.5031 RMB in 2015[20]. - The weighted average return on equity for 2016 was 2.47%, recovering from -18.98% in the previous year[20]. - The company reported an increase in the basic earnings per share, with a year-on-year growth of 114.06% compared to 2015[20]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2016 was CNY 110,306,718.92, a significant recovery from a loss of CNY 612,220,333.31 in 2015[21]. - The company's operating revenue for 2016 was CNY 2,335,888,273.97, a decrease of 10.81% compared to CNY 2,618,861,252.65 in 2015[21]. - The net cash flow from operating activities increased dramatically to CNY 1,323,304,570.71, up 5398.10% from CNY 24,068,402.58 in 2015[21]. - The company's total assets reached CNY 14,200,707,998.69, reflecting a 3.90% increase from CNY 13,667,897,960.74 in 2015[21]. - The company's net assets attributable to shareholders grew by 125.72% to CNY 6,595,689,944.29 from CNY 2,922,103,277.51 in 2015[21]. - The company achieved operating revenue of CNY 2,335,888,273.97, a decrease of 10.81% compared to the previous year[34]. - The net cash flow from operating activities increased to CNY 1,323,304,570.71, a remarkable increase of 5,398.10% year-on-year[36]. - The company’s total assets included cash and cash equivalents of CNY 3,386,785,714.77, reflecting a 123% increase due to funds from a private placement and increased sales[29]. - The company’s total assets included cash and cash equivalents of CNY 3,386,785,714.77, representing 23.85% of total assets, up from 11.11% in the previous period[44]. - The inventory value decreased to CNY 8,670,768,392.58, accounting for 61.06% of total assets, down from 72.60% year-over-year[44]. - The company reported a total comprehensive income of CNY 99,813,279.23 for 2016, compared to a loss of CNY 584,599,726.19 in 2015[165]. Financing Activities - The company completed a private placement of 837,209,302 shares, increasing its total shares to 2,054,009,302[33]. - The company completed a non-public offering of shares, ensuring compliance with relevant regulations and avoiding any financial assistance to subscription objects or final investors[79]. - The company has committed to not providing any financial assistance or compensation to the subscription objects of the stock issuance[78]. - The company has established a lock-up period for shares issued in the non-public offering, lasting from August 4, 2016, to August 3, 2019[81]. - The company completed a non-public issuance of A-shares totaling 837,209,302 shares, increasing the total share capital to 2,054,009,302 shares[104]. - The completion of the private placement improved the company's financial structure and reduced financial costs, although it diluted earnings per share due to the increase in share capital[105]. - The total financing amount at the end of the period was 3.772 billion yuan, with an average financing cost of 7.36%[55]. Employee and Management Information - The company employed a total of 436 staff members, including 89 in the parent company and 347 in major subsidiaries[136]. - The professional composition of employees includes 97 production personnel, 135 sales personnel, 68 technical personnel, 52 financial personnel, and 84 administrative personnel[136]. - The company has a total of 43 employees with a graduate degree or above, 230 with a bachelor's degree, 143 with a college diploma, and 20 with other educational backgrounds[136]. - The total remuneration for directors and senior management during the reporting period amounted to RMB 9,683,457.09 (pre-tax)[133]. - The company has not granted any stock incentives to directors and senior management during the reporting period[131]. - The company is committed to creating a learning culture and has established a training system to enhance employee professionalism and alignment with core values[138]. Market and Industry Trends - The real estate industry remains heavily influenced by policy adjustments, with a shift from "one city, one policy" to more localized strategies for inventory reduction[27]. - The total area of unsold commercial housing in China at the end of 2016 was 695 million square meters, a decrease of 23.14 million square meters or 3.2% compared to the end of 2015, marking the lowest level since 2011[48]. - The new construction area of commercial housing in 2016 was 1.669 billion square meters, an increase of 8.08% year-on-year, with the growth rate turning positive[48]. - Real estate development investment for the year was 10.3 trillion yuan,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 6.9%[48].
